Our Spotlight this week focuses on David Cates . Our Senior Contract Services Specialist.
David has always been interested in aviation, beginning with the models of WWII aircraft he made as a child. Growing up in North Carolina, (where his brother and brother in law worked at RDU as Ramp Agents for Eastern Airlines), he was fortunate to have them take him countless times to experience the airport activities close up and personal. Upon graduating from High School, David was hired as a Ramp Agent with Piedmont Airlines. Within a year, (unsure of career expectations as most 19 year olds are), he joined the Navy, becoming an Aviation Electrician’s Mate, working on F14A fighter jets (Tomcats) as part of the East Coast’s first two F14A squadrons and serving onboard the aircraft carrier, USS John F Kennedy.
Having met his bride during the last year of his enlistment, David returned stateside but being unable to land a job in the aviation field, (economic downturn at that time), he took a detour and began a long career within the computer industry. In addition to obtaining an A.A.S in Business Administration along the way, he has performed many roles within Manufacturing, QA, Administration, Services, Marketing and Purchasing… all of which assisted in his being led to Southwest Airlines (by way of Monster.com).
David thoroughly enjoys working in support of aircraft maintenance, as a Senior Contracts Services Specialist within the MX Contract Services team. He learned Customer service at an early age, (cutting lawns and as a gas station attendant…before they became primarily self service), so Customer service and satisfaction remains the number one goal of his at Southwest and looks forward to the same result with the challenges faced in his present day to day activities.
David and his wife, DeeAnna have 5 kids (3 boys and 2 girls) in addition to 9 grandchildren. Along with his family and friends, his interests and hobbies include golf, movies, music, history, hiking, bowling, Southwest’s many culture events…brew and just enjoying life.
